We are currently seeking a kind, reliable, and patient Personal Care Assistant to support a friendly and active young adult living with Down syndrome. This individual is mobile and enjoys routine, social interaction, and engaging activities, but requires some daily support with personal care and life skills.

Responsibilities
  • Assist with personal hygiene tasks, including toileting and bathing as needed
  • Support with dressing and grooming
  • Help with meal preparation and light kitchen clean‑up
  • Provide supervision and encouragement during daily activities
  • Engage in social and recreational activities when appropriate
  • Ensure a safe and supportive environment
  • Assist with reminders and routines
Qualifications
  • Previous experience working with individuals with developmental disabilities is an asset
  • Personal Support Worker (PSW) certificate or similar background is preferred but not required
  • Compassionate, respectful, and dependable
  • Strong communication skills
  • Able to follow directions and work both independently and as part of a team
  • CPR and First Aid certification (or willingness to obtain)
Additional Information
  • A valid driver’s license and access to a vehicle is an asset but not required
  • Vulnerable Sector Police Check required prior to start
  • Competitive hourly rate based on experience
